How the Introducer Programme works

1

Introduce your client

Send your client’s details to your dedicated contact.

2

We take it from there

We manage the sales conversation, answer technical questions and recommend the right support.

3

You earn commission

When the deal completes, you receive competitive commission, it’s as simple as that.
